Jump to content
php.lv forumi

Recommended Posts

Posted

Sveiki!

Es jau atkal par encoding!

Respektīvi, manā lapā vajadzēs rādīties vienlīdz labi savās valodās latviešu, angļu, krievu un vācu teksti! Izmantojot encodingu "utf-8" rādās kaut kādi kvadrātiņi latviešu burtu vietā, taču izmantojot "windows-1257" krievu burti ļoti labi rādās kopā ar latviešu burtiem!

Vai gadījumā nav tā, ka windows-1257 ir universāls encodings un drošāks par "utf-8"? Vai nevarētu būt problēmas apskatīt šo lapu arī vāciešiem, angļiem, krieviem uz savām sistēmām, ja lapai ir uzlikts encoding windows-1257 ???

Man jau šitais interesē!

P.S. encodingu sūtu, izmantojot:

header("Content-type:text/html;charset=windows-1257");

Posted

a tu kā tos tekstus UTF-8 kodējumā raksti? saproti, ja gribi rādīt tekstus UTF-8 formātā, tad tie arī jāsaglabā UTF-8 formātā!

Posted

Es neesmu pārliecināts vai viņus saglabāju zem utf, jo glabāju iekš EditPlus programmas... Kā tad var saglabāt utf un vai mysql bāzē arī tā var saglabāt ?

Posted

ar taadu kodeejumu kaa ieliec datu baazee, ar taadu arii velc laukaa. citaadaak jau nekas nesanaaks...

 

nu paprovee insertot datu baazee no formas, kur header ir utf-8 un tad paskaties kaa ar attieciigi utf-8 header naak laukaa dati. tad vajadzeetu visam buut kaa naakas

Posted
Es neesmu pārliecināts vai viņus saglabāju zem utf, jo glabāju iekš EditPlus programmas... Kā tad var saglabāt utf un vai mysql bāzē arī tā var saglabāt ?

Windows XP nāk līdzi laba utilīta: notepad.exe

Ar tās palīdzību var tekstu saglabāt kā UTF-8.

Atver notepadā tukšu failu, tad ar copy paste ieliec tur tekstu, un pie seivošanas norādi, ka encodins tev būs UTF-8

×
×
  • Create New...